html, body {
  height: 100%; }

body {
  padding-top: 50px;
  top: 2px; }

/* .navbar */
/*   opacity: .8 */
a.navbar-brand {
  padding: 5px 15px 15px 15px; }

.navbar-nav > li > a {
  font-size: 18px; }

.navbar-collapse {
  width: auto; }

.navbar-default {
  border-radius: 7px;
  -webkit-transition: padding 3s;
  -moz-transition: padding 3s;
  transition: padding 3s; }
  .navbar-default .navbar-nav > .active > a {
    border-radius: 7px; }

h1, h2, h3, h4, h5 {
  color: #73989a; }

#logo {
  font-family: "Josefin Sans", sans-serif;
  font-size: 24px; }

.glyphicon-fix {
  /* vertical-align: middle */
  padding-left: 15px;
  /* line-height: inherit */
  top: 4px; }

span.band-name, span.band-name-inverse {
  /* color: darken( rgb(115,152,154), 20% ) */
  color: #73989a;
  /* background: rgb(115,152,154) */
  /* color: white */
  padding: 4px 1px;
  font-size: 120%;
  /* border: thin solid */
  border-radius: 2px;
  border-color: #73989a;
  font-family: "Josefin Sans", sans-serif; }

span.band-name-inverse {
  /* font-family: serif */
  /* font-size: 16px */
  border-radius: 0.7em;
  position: relative;
  top: 0.1em;
  padding: 2px 3px 0px 3px;
  color: white;
  background: #73989a; }

section {
  height: 100%;
  width: 100%;
  display: table;
  vertical-align: middle;
  padding-top: 50px; }

section#home {
  background-image: url(/images/band_cinema.png);
  background-position: center center;
  -webkit-background-size: cover;
  -moz-background-size: cover;
  background-size: cover;
  -o-background-size: cover;
  text-align: center;
  /* padding: 200px 140px */ }

.container {
  height: 100%; }

/* .vertical-middle-row, .container */
/*   display: table-cell */
/*   width: 100% */
/*   vertical-align: middle */
/*   text-align: center */
.boilerplate .wells {
  font-size: 28px;
  color: #73989a;
  background: #eeeeee;
  border-radius: 5px;
  opacity: 0.8;
  margin-top: 10px; }
  .boilerplate .wells:hover {
    border: 2px solid #ffd5a4;
    background: #466061;
    color: #ffd5a4; }

section#sound {
  background-color: #eaefef; }

.track {
  cursor: pointer; }
  .track:hover {
    background: #547374;
    color: #ffd5a4; }

section#contact {
  background-color: #eaefef;
  padding: 180px 0 150px 0;
  height: 90%; }
  @media (min-width: 768px) {
    section#contact {
      padding: 220px 0 180px 0; } }
  section#contact .section-heading {
    color: #fff; }

.flower-bg {
  background-image: url(/images/background.png);
  background-repeat: no-repeat;
  background-position: right 50px; }

footer {
  padding-top: 15px;
  font-size: 80%;
  height: 50px; }

/*# sourceMappingURL=custom.css.map */

/*
     FILE ARCHIVED ON 10:51:46 Feb 06, 2019 AND RETRIEVED FROM THE
     INTERNET ARCHIVE ON 20:02:40 Apr 03, 2023.
     JAVASCRIPT APPENDED BY WAYBACK MACHINE, COPYRIGHT INTERNET ARCHIVE.

     ALL OTHER CONTENT MAY ALSO BE PROTECTED BY COPYRIGHT (17 U.S.C.
     SECTION 108(a)(3)).
*/
/*
playback timings (ms):
  captures_list: 119.461
  exclusion.robots: 0.109
  exclusion.robots.policy: 0.095
  RedisCDXSource: 0.708
  esindex: 0.011
  LoadShardBlock: 94.083 (3)
  PetaboxLoader3.datanode: 89.217 (5)
  load_resource: 908.321 (2)
  PetaboxLoader3.resolve: 812.146 (2)
*/
